May 3, 2002

Dear Sir,

Herewith a copy of a letter to the Hon. Alex Scott, Minister of Works and Engineering which I have sent today.

Dear Mr. Scott.

I was shocked and very angry to see the devastation inflicted on my property on Harbour Road by the 'roadside cleaning' gang from your Department. The land is private waterfront opposite Cliff Lodge, 86 Harbour Road, Paget, PG 02.

There can be no excuse of either sight obstruction or impingement on the roadway. The vegetation is mostly palms which are growing nine to ten feet below the road and separated from it by a wall. The men have hacked off the tops and almost all the other leaves to a distance of eight to ten feet, leaving in some cases one wispy centre leaf and in others nothing. It is doubtful that any of them will recover. To add insult to injury, all the debris has been dropped on the ground with apparently no attempt to remove it.

In addition to the ugly mess, it is very sad that this vegetation was sheltering one of the last areas of Longtail nesting sites in Hamilton Harbour. There is, as you know, a great deal of traffic on Harbour Road and the palms were an important buffer for the birds.

It is inexcusable that your men are not supervised by someone who has some conception of sensitive, or even just plain sensible pruning. In short I am furious.

Yours in disgust.

ELFRIDA L. CHAPPELL
